
การนำเสนอ PowerPoint PPTX ได้กลายเป็นสื่อมาตรฐานสำหรับการสื่อสารในหลากหลายสาขาตั้งแต่การประชุมทางธุรกิจไปจนถึงการนำเสนองานวิชาการด้วยภาพที่เคลื่อนไหวและรูปแบบที่มีโครงสร้าง อย่างไรก็ตามการสร้างการนำเสนอเหล่านี้อาจใช้เวลานาน โดยเฉพาะเมื่อเนื้อหามีอยู่แล้วในรูปแบบ HTML ดังนั้นบทความนี้จึงแก้ปัญหาโดยการอธิบายการแปลง HTML เป็น PPTX ใน Java
เครื่องมือแปลง HTML เว็บเพจเป็น PPTX - การตั้งค่า Java API
คุณสามารถกำหนดค่า API อย่างรวดเร็วโดยการดาวน์โหลดไฟล์ JAR จากส่วน New Releases หรือ ติดตั้ง Conholdate.Total for Java ด้วยการตั้งค่า Maven ต่อไปนี้:
<dependency>
<groupId>com.conholdate</groupId>
<artifactId>conholdate-total</artifactId>
<version>24.2</version>
<type>pom</type>
</dependency>
ทำไมต้องแปลง HTML เป็น PPTX?
ก่อนที่จะดำดิ่งสู่ด้านเทคนิค มาทำความเข้าใจกันว่าทำไมการแปลง HTML เป็น PPTX จึงอาจเป็นสิ่งที่จำเป็น
Reuse Existing Content: บางครั้งเนื้อหาต้นฉบับมีอยู่ในรูปแบบ HTML ซึ่งสร้างขึ้นแบบไดนามิกจากแอปพลิเคชันเว็บหรือเขียนโดยโปรแกรมแก้ไข HTML
ความสอดคล้องและการสร้างแบรนด์: การแปลง HTML เป็นสไลด์ PPTX ช่วยให้ความสอดคล้องในแบรนด์และการจัดรูปแบบทั่วทั้งสื่อที่แตกต่างกัน
Automation: การทำให้กระบวนการแปลงอัตโนมัติสามารถประหยัดเวลาและความพยายามได้ โดยเฉพาะในสถานการณ์ที่ต้องสร้างการนำเสนอหลายรายการแบบไดนามิก
แปลง HTML เป็น PowerPoint PPTX ใน Java
คุณต้องปฏิบัติตามขั้นตอนด้านล่างเพื่อแปลง HTML เป็น PPTX ใน Java:
- โหลดไฟล์ HTML แหล่งข้อมูลด้วยคลาส HTMLDocument.
- สร้างออบเจ็กต์ของคลาส PdfSaveOptions
- แสดงไฟล์ HTML เป็นเอกสาร PDF โดยใช้วิธี convertHTML
- โหลดไฟล์ PDF ที่สร้างขึ้นโดยใช้คลาส Document.
- เริ่มต้นอินสแตนซ์ของคลาส PptxSaveOptions
- ส่งออก HTML เป็นงานนำเสนอ PPTX ด้วยวิธีการบันทึก
โค้ดตัวอย่างต่อไปนี้แสดงวิธีการแปลง HTML เป็นการนำเสนอ PPTX ใน Java:
// เริ่มเอกสาร HTML จากไฟล์
var document = new com.aspose.html.HTMLDocument("spring.html");
// เริ่มต้น PdfSaveOptions
var options = new com.aspose.html.saving.PdfSaveOptions();
// แปลง HTML เป็น PDF
com.aspose.html.converters.Converter.convertHTML(document, options, "spring-output.pdf");
// โหลดเอกสาร PDF
com.aspose.pdf.Document doc = new com.aspose.pdf.Document("spring-output.pdf");
// สร้างอินสแตนซ์ PptxSaveOptions
com.aspose.pdf.PptxSaveOptions pptx_save = new com.aspose.pdf.PptxSaveOptions();
// บันทึกผลลัพธ์ในรูปแบบ PPTX
doc.save("PDFToPPTX.pptx", pptx_save);
ใบอนุญาตการประเมินผลฟรี
คุณสามารถขอ free temporary license เพื่อพัฒนา POS สำหรับเข้าถึงและประเมินฟีเจอร์ API หลายรายการให้เต็มศักยภาพ.
สรุป
การแปลง HTML เป็น PPTX ใน Java เปิดโอกาสในการสร้างงานนำเสนออัตโนมัติและใช้เนื้อหาที่มีอยู่ได้อย่างราบรื่น คุณสามารถแปลงเนื้อหา HTML ให้เป็นงานนำเสนอ PowerPoint ที่ดึงดูดสายตามากขึ้นได้อย่างมีประสิทธิภาพ การแปลงนี้มีประโยชน์ในสถานการณ์ต่างๆ เช่น เมื่อคุณกำลังสร้างระบบการจัดการเนื้อหา เครื่องมือรายงาน หรือแพลตฟอร์มการศึกษา นอกจากนี้ คุณยังสามารถพูดคุยเกี่ยวกับความต้องการและกรณีการใช้งานที่กำหนดเองเพื่อปรับแต่งการแปลงได้โดยการติดต่อเราที่ forum.
FAQs
Can I convert complex HTML content with images and styling to PPTX using Java?
ใช่ สามารถแปลงเนื้อหา HTML ที่ซับซ้อนที่มีภาพ การจัดรูปแบบ และการออกแบบเป็น PPTX โดยใช้ Java ได้
มีข้อจำกัดอะไรบ้างในการแปลง HTML เป็น PPTX ใน Java หรือไม่?
ในขณะที่ API มีความสามารถที่แข็งแกร่งสำหรับการแปลง HTML เป็น PPTX แต่ก็อาจมีข้อจำกัดบางประการ โดยเฉพาะเมื่อจัดการกับโครงสร้าง HTML ที่ซับซ้อนหรือฟีเจอร์ CSS นอกจากนี้ การจัดเรียงที่ซับซ้อนหรือการจัดแต่งขั้นสูงอาจต้องการการปรับแต่งเพิ่มเติม
Can I automate the conversion process for bulk HTML files?
ใช่ คุณสามารถทำให้กระบวนการแปลงไฟล์ HTML แบบกลุ่มอัตโนมัติโดยการนำโลจิกการประมวลผลแบบแบตช์มาใช้ ตราบใดที่ไฟล์เดียวกันไม่ได้ถูกประมวลผลพร้อมกัน
Can I convert HTML to other presentation formats besides PPTX using Java?
ใช่ ไลบรารี Java นี้สามารถใช้เพื่อสนับสนุนการแปลงเป็นรูปแบบการนำเสนอที่แตกต่างกันนอกเหนือจาก PPTX เช่น PPT หรือ ODP (OpenDocument Presentation)